Tell us about a time when you had to provide crisis intervention over the phone or chat. How did you effectively support the client?
Sample answer to the question:
I once had a client call in a state of crisis. They were feeling overwhelmed and suicidal. I immediately created a safe space for them to express their feelings and ensured them that I was there to support them. I actively listened to their concerns and validated their emotions. To effectively support them, I utilized crisis intervention techniques such as grounding exercises and relaxation techniques. I provided them with resources for immediate help, such as hotlines and local crisis centers. Throughout the conversation, I maintained a calm and empathetic tone, reassuring them of their worth and emphasizing that they were not alone. By the end of the call, the client felt more stable and had a safety plan in place.
Here is a more solid answer:
In a previous role, I encountered a situation where a client reached out to me in a state of crisis over the phone. It was important for me to establish rapport and build trust quickly. I calmly introduced myself and assured the client of my commitment to their well-being. I actively listened to their concerns and asked open-ended questions to gather more information about their situation. Through my empathetic tone and gentle reassurance, I validated their emotions and created a safe space for them to open up. I utilized my clinical skills to assess the severity of the crisis and identified immediate interventions to ensure their safety. I talked them through grounding exercises and guided them in deep breathing to help regulate their emotions. Additionally, I provided them with resources for professional help, including crisis hotlines and local mental health services. By the end of the call, the client reported feeling more supported and had a safety plan in place.
Why is this a more solid answer?
The solid answer expands on the basic answer by providing specific details about the communication skills used, the establishment of rapport, and the clinical interventions employed. However, it could still benefit from further elaboration on the effectiveness of the support provided and the outcome of the crisis intervention.
An example of a exceptional answer:
During my time as a Telehealth Therapist, I encountered a critical situation where a client called me in severe distress. It was clear that immediate intervention was necessary to ensure their safety. Understanding the urgency, I swiftly established a connection by actively listening to their distress and acknowledging their emotions without judgment. I utilized my clinical skills to conduct a rapid assessment, identifying key risk factors and protective factors. Collaboratively, we formulated a safety plan that involved identifying supportive individuals in their network and exploring coping strategies. Throughout the call, I employed crisis intervention techniques to help ground the client and stabilize their emotional state. I guided them through a progressive muscle relaxation exercise and utilized positive affirmation statements to instill hope and resilience. I also provided them with resources for ongoing support, including crisis helplines and virtual support groups. By the end of the call, the client expressed gratitude for the immediate support provided and reported feeling calmer and more empowered to navigate their crisis. Their feedback affirmed the effectiveness of the crisis intervention.
Why is this an exceptional answer?
The exceptional answer goes into great detail about the communication skills used, the rapid assessment process, and the specific crisis intervention techniques implemented. It also discusses the outcome of the crisis intervention and the client's feedback, demonstrating the effectiveness of the support provided.
How to prepare for this question:
  • Familiarize yourself with crisis intervention techniques, such as grounding exercises and relaxation techniques.
  • Practice active listening skills to ensure you can effectively understand and validate clients' emotions.
  • Research local and national crisis hotlines and resources to provide immediate support options to clients.
  • Review ethical guidelines and laws pertaining to crisis intervention and telehealth services.
  • Reflect on past experiences providing crisis intervention and think of specific examples to share during the interview.
What are interviewers evaluating with this question?
  • Verbal and written communication skills
  • Clinical skills
  • Engaging clients effectively
